Ida Belle Owens 1872–1975 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 28 JUL 1872

Birth Location: Pleasant Hill, Jefferson County, IL

Death Date: 27 JAN 1975

Death Location: Pleasant Hill Cemetery, Jefferson County, IL

Father: Shadrack Owens

Mother: Delilah Bickmore

Spouse(s): Willus Frazier

Children(s): Clarence Frazier

In 1872, Ida Belle Owens entered the world in Pleasant Hill, Jefferson County, IL, born to Shadrack Owens And Delilah Bickmore. Ida Belle Owens married Frank Shipley, Willus Eugene Gene Frazier, and had children including Arthur Frazier Shipley, Beulah Shipley, Clarence Frazier, Cora Shipley. Ida Belle Owens passed away in 1975 in Pleasant Hill Cemetery, Jefferson County, IL.
